Description
The ground floor centres around an open-plan kitchen and dining area, creating a practical and sociable space, with additional reception rooms providing further versatility. There are also useful additions such as a utility room and internal access to the garage. Across the upper floors, the property continues to offer well-proportioned accommodation, including a principal bedroom with dressing area and ensuite, alongside further bedrooms and bathroom facilities.
Externally, the property benefits from a double driveway to the front and an enclosed rear garden which enjoys a southerly facing aspect and has been designed with ease of maintenance in mind. An attached garden room provides additional usable space that could suit a range of purposes depending on requirements.
The property is located in a residential area with access to a range of everyday amenities including local shops, supermarkets and schools. Wakefield city centre is within a short drive, offering a broader selection of retail, dining and leisure facilities, as well as rail connections to Leeds and other destinations. The area also provides access to the M1 motorway network, supporting travel across the region, along with nearby green spaces and walking routes.

Points to note
Upon acceptance of an offer deemed acceptable by the seller, we require a payment of £30.00 (including VAT at 20%) per named purchaser. This amount is made up of £25.00 plus £5.00 VAT.
This fee covers the cost of Anti-Money Laundering (AML) checks and associated administration. AML checks are a legal requirement under the Money Laundering, Terrorist Financing and Transfer of Funds (Information on the Payer) Regulations 2017.
Please note:
This fee is strictly non-refundable in all circumstances, including where a purchase does not proceed.
The fee relates solely to the performance of mandatory compliance checks and is not a deposit or contribution towards the purchase price.
